Mainland Graduate Students Earn Less than Delivery Drivers, Sparking Controversy over Their "Brain-Body Inversion"

Two recent recruitment announcements in mainland China have sparked heated public debate: the CCP Haikou District Development and Reform Commission in Hainan Province published a job advertisement offering a monthly salary of just 3,000 yuan for graduates and 2,700 yuan for bachelor's degrees. Meanwhile, retail giant Pang Donglai in Xinxiang, Henan Province, is hiring for security and cleaning positions, offering salaries of "nearly 9,000 yuan."…
